Optical concepts for a combined low-beam and high-beam out of a single LED

摘要

In the past,many automotive lighting functions have been realized by designs that statically provide specific illumination patterns.In contrast,existing adaptive designs comprise either moving shutters or electronically-complex matrix sources.In this article,we explore alternative options for a combined low-beam and high-beam out of a single LED.In order to reduce the electronic complexity and at the same time to come up with a compact LED for the light source we resort to two rows of chips arranged on a common carrier.The two rows can be independently driven.Adjacent primary optics collects the emission of the two closely-spaced chip rows and simultaneously provides a way to separate respective contributions.The subsequent secondary optics is based on conventional reflector/projector configurations to realize low-beam and high-beam distributions.In such systems,efficiency,tolerances,and system size are evaluated with respect to different primary optics based on refraction,reflection and TIR.
